Washer vs. Rubber Spacer

Washer vs. Rubber Spacer

Washers are disk-shaped objects that are typically made of metal or plastic. They are used to distribute the pressure of a fastener, such as a bolt or a screw, over a larger area. This prevents the fastener from becoming loose over time and also helps to protect surfaces from damage.

Rubber spacers are similar to washers because they distribute pressure and protect surfaces. However, they are made of rubber instead of metal or plastic. This makes them ideal for use in environments where vibration is a concern, as the rubber will help to dampen the vibrations. In addition, rubber spacers can be used in applications requiring electrical insulation.

Rubber spacers are essential in many automotive, aerospace, and construction industries. They fill gaps between parts and prevent them from moving or shifting. They are also resistant to most chemicals, oils, and solvents, making them ideal for use in industrial settings.

Rubber spacers are also used to reduce noise and vibration. They are made from different materials, including natural rubber, neoprene, silicone, and EPDM. Rubber spacers are available in a wide range of sizes and shapes to meet the needs of any application.

Washers vs. Rubber Spacers

In the construction world, there are various ways to complete a project. Washers and rubber spacers are standard options to secure bolts or other fasteners. While both washers and spacers have a similar purpose, they each have unique benefits and drawbacks.

Washers are typically made from metal, making them very strong and durable. On the other hand, rubber spacers are designed to be flexible and compressible. This makes them ideal for absorbing vibrations and reducing noise levels.

In terms of cost, washers are generally more expensive than rubber spacers. However, they can be reused multiple times to offset the initial cost over time.
